When a benign disorder that has
no effect on longevity and has no known association
with disease or cancer has an economic cost to our
society of $30 billion and these individuals are
undergoing nearly twice as many abdominal surgeries
as people without IBS and suffer with significant
numbers of missing work days and loss of
productivity and impairment at work, as a medical
community we need to do more.
This site is an attempt to positively impact through education and alternative strategies of management this tremendous burden to our society.
